[Career] EE vs CE

i'm about to choose one of these majors and need to know the futurue prospects. i'm interested in robotics, chip design, embedded.

If you want chip design your gonna need to be EE and go onto EE masters

Robotics you can do either.

Embedded, depends on what you want to do with it. CE is very tailored for firmware programming. But EE is going be a bit better for designing the hardware.

CE get more programming experience and less EE. But CEs get less programming then CS AND EE do power and electromagnetism
